Venous disease is a condition impacting a large portion of the US population. 50% of women and 40% of men suffer from a venous problem. Chronic venous insufficiency (CVI) is one of the most common types of venous disease. CVI affects 25 million Americans, or roughly 5% of the US population. One of the biggest misnomers surrounding CVI is simply that it is another term for varicose veins. However, CVI can encompass a wide variety of comorbidities including hereditary, hormonal, trauma, and previous deep vein thrombosis. If left untreated, CVI can lead to edema, chronic life-threatening infections of the lower extremities, and blood clots.
